How many months did your Enyaq take from order to final delivery?

1
11
3%
2
6
1%
3
13
3%
4
38
9%
5
31
7%
6
9
2%
More than 6
82
19%
Still waiting : 0-3 months so far
18
4%
Still waiting : 4-6 months so far
36
8%
Still waiting : over 6 months so far
187
43%
 
Total votes: 431
